ANNOUNCEMENT: The new Ralph Stanley II CD is finally here! This One Is Two (a reference to Stanley’s nickname) showcases 11 emotionally probing songs by the best writers in the business, among them Lyle Lovett, Townes Van Zandt, Fred Eaglesmith, Tom T. and Dixie Hall and Elton John. Stanley co-wrote two of the songs: “Honky Tonk Way,” a tough, grimy, up-close look at a country singer’s life on the road, and “Lord Help Me Find The Way,” a cry from the heart he composed when he was suddenly forced to stand in for his famous father.

A particular jewel in this musical treasure chest is “Carter,” Fred Eaglesmith’s mournful valedictory to Stanley’s uncle, the late Carter Stanley of Stanley Brothers fame. In “Cold Shoulder,” Stanley immerses himself in the mind and heart of a lonely trucker who’s snowbound at night miles away from his lover. He resurrects Lyle Lovett’s chilling murder saga, “L. A. County,” a song he refers to as “my ‘Pretty Polly.’”

Stanley turned to ace storyteller Tom T. Hall for the album’s first single, the high-velocity, relentlessly clacking “Train Songs.” From Elton John he borrows the lyrical and sun-loving “Georgia.” Songwriter Elmer C. Burchett Jr. brought Stanley the sweetest “mother” song of recent memory, “Moms Are The Reason Wild Flowers Grow.”

Lonesome Day Records offers the best in bluegrass music including: Lou Reid and Carolina and their hit album Time. The title track spent an incredible 3 months in a row at 1 on Bluegrass Unlimited's National Reporting Survey's Top 30 Single chart; Blue Moon Rising's album, On the Rise has had great success on the same chart with the single This Old Martin Box spending 12 consecutive months (the entire 2006 calendar year) on the Top 30 Single chartt and the album ten months on the BU Top 15 Album Chart. Randy Kohrs critically acclaimed album, I'm Torn that featured two chart singles including a duet with Dolly Parton. Please visit our website for a complete list of albums available.
